What does a quality assurance quality control inspector do?

A Quality Assurance Quality Control (QA/QC) Inspector is responsible for ensuring that products, materials, or processes meet established quality standards and specifications. They inspect, test, and sample materials or manufactured goods for defects and deviations from specifications. By maintaining detailed records and reports, QA/QC Inspectors help identify issues early and recommend corrective actions to improve quality. Their role is crucial in industries such as manufacturing, construction, and pharmaceuticals, where consistent product quality and safety are essential.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a quality assurance quality control inspector?

To thrive as a Quality Assurance Quality Control Inspector, you need a keen attention to detail, strong analytical skills, and an understanding of quality standards, often supported by a background in engineering or manufacturing and relevant certifications like ASQ. Familiarity with inspection tools, measurement devices, and quality management systems (QMS) such as ISO 9001 is typically required. Strong communication, problem-solving abilities, and integrity help you effectively identify issues and collaborate with production teams. These skills and qualities ensure that products consistently meet regulatory and customer standards, minimizing defects and maintaining company reputation.

What are some common challenges quality assurance quality control inspectors face when working with cross-functional teams?

Quality Assurance Quality Control Inspectors often collaborate with production, engineering, and supply chain teams to ensure products meet required standards. A common challenge is balancing strict quality protocols with production deadlines, which can create tension between departments. Effective communication and problem-solving skills are essential for navigating these situations and ensuring everyone is aligned on quality priorities. Building strong working relationships and being proactive in identifying potential issues helps foster a cooperative environment and maintain product quality.

How do you become a quality assurance quality control inspector?

To become a quality assurance quality control inspector, candidates typically need a high school diploma or equivalent, along with relevant experience in manufacturing or quality control. Many employers prefer candidates with certifications such as ASQ Certified Quality Inspector (CQI) or similar, and strong attention to detail, inspection skills, and knowledge of industry standards are essential.
